The BlueOptics QSFP-40G-LR4-20-BR-BO is a QSFP transceiver module engineered for 40 Gbit/s optical links. Designed for use in high-density network environments, this module supports long-range single-mode fiber connections with LC connectors and a maximum reach of 20,000 m. With a compact form factor and a weight of 40 g, it integrates into switches, routers and media converters that accept QSFP interfaces to deliver stable high-speed connectivity in data centers and enterprise networks.

Advantages

The transceiver provides a standardized QSFP interface for easy hot-plug installation and interoperability with compatible network equipment. It supports 40 Gbit/s aggregated bandwidth over LR4 wavelength division multiplexing, enabling long-reach single-mode links while maintaining low physical footprint and energy-efficient operation. Its LC fiber connectivity and 20 km maximum distance make it suitable for campus, metro and inter-site links where single-mode fiber is available.

How to use

Install the QSFP module into a compatible QSFP port on network equipment while the device is powered according to the vendor's guidance for hot-plug transceivers. Connect single-mode LC fiber patch cords to the module's LC ports, ensuring correct polarity and secure connections. Confirm link status and port configuration on the switch or router management interface; configure speed and mode if required by the host device. Follow equipment-specific procedures for transceiver diagnostics and firmware compatibility.

Recommendations

Use single-mode fiber with appropriate LC patch cords and ensure connectors are clean before insertion. Verify compatibility with the host device's QSFP ports and configure link settings per the network design. For distances approaching the maximum reach, use quality single-mode fiber and maintain proper fiber routing to minimize loss.
